The short answer to your question is: for pocket change, learn the magic find runs with custom characters. Normal Meph offers over 200% of MF items in his drops, use that to bootstrap. For real value, learn to craft and practice trading (never accept the first 3 offers, never believe anyone trying to rush you, never deal with only one person, always answer publically for any PMs -- keeps other bidders informed, it's only worth what someone else will pay so find all those someone elses and make them compete). Pocket change adds up and crafting makes good MF drops seem like rain. Routes I did not take were chipped cubing of swords and one other method I've forgotten. Every once in awhile, when you have encountered a true beginner, give stuff away. The wealth you get from that is not measured in SOJs.
